"Squeak,
Piggy, Squeak!"
(blindfold
– optional)
You will need:
- a medium to large play space
- a group of children
- a blind fold (a
child’s winter scarf works well)
What to do:
- one child wears the blindfold,
the rest of the children stand close to the blindfolded child
- the blindfolded child feels
around until he touches someone, the blindfolded child says, "Squeak,
piggy, squeak"
- the caught child must say,
"Squeak, squeak" the blindfolded child must then try and identify
the caught child
- when this has been done, the
children trade places and the game continues, game ends when all children
have had a chance to be blindfolded
Special
Note:
- some young children do not
like to be blindfolded - they should not be forced!
- sometimes it is helpful to
have a mask pre-made with no eye-holes
- this is somewhat less threatening
and is intriguing too!
